SCOUTING REPORT: The former defender aims for his fourth letter as one of the team[apos]s best offensive linemen in 2008 ... depending on whether the RedHawk quarterback is a right-hander or a left-hander, he will be played at the tackle spot that protects the all-important backside ... will be a third-year starter.
2007: Started all 13 games at right tackle ... altogether he has been a starter in 21 games, including the last 19 in a row ... he and Miami[apos]s other offensive linemen gained the unique honor of being named the Mid-American Conference[apos]s Offensive Player of the Week for their performance vs. Buffalo ... graded out at 82 percent and allowed only two sacks ... had 58 knock-downs and eight pins ... recorded six games with a championship performance (grading out at higher than 80 percent, no penalties, and no sacks).
2006: Started eight of the team[apos]s 12 games, including the last six consecutive contests ... first year on offensive line after spending first two seasons at Miami on the defensive side of the ball.
2005: Saw action in seven games at defensive end, making three tackles.
2004: Redshirted.
HIGH SCHOOL: Four-year letterwinner while filling a variety of positions at St. Henry High School ... first-team all-conference pick on both sides of the ball as a senior ... selected to compete in Ohio[apos]s North-South All-Star game ... coached by Jeffrey Starkey ... also a four-year letterwinner in basketball and three-time letterwinner in track and field.
PERSONAL: Son of David and Phyllis Sutter ... earned Eagle Scout honors ... majoring in engineering management at Miami.
